Gap Theory is in the Bible, and it is true.
Jeremiah 4:23-26 says, I beheld the earth, and, lo, it was without form, and void; and the heavens, and they had no light. [24] I beheld the mountains, and, lo, they trembled, and all the hills moved lightly. [25] I beheld, and, lo, there was no man, and all the birds of the heavens were fled. [26] I beheld, and, lo, the fruitful place was a wilderness, and all the cities thereof were broken down at the presence of the LORD, and by his fierce anger.
The prophet is describing the condition of the Earth in Genesis 1:2. Allow me to demonstrate:
[1] In the beginning God created the heaven and the earth. [2] And the earth was without form, and void [23]; and the heavens, and they had no light. [24] I beheld the mountains, and, lo, they trembled, and all the hills moved lightly. [25] I beheld, and, lo, there was no man, and all the birds of the heavens were fled. [26] I beheld, and, lo, the fruitful place was a wilderness, and all the cities thereof were broken down at the presence of the LORD, and by his fierce anger. [3] And God said, Let there be light: and there was light.
At what other time, beside the account of Genesis, was the Earth without form and void, and dark?
